Stop Dirty Tar Sands Oil Coming Through Maine!
The Canadian oil and gas giant Enbridge is proposing to pump
dirty tar sands
oil from Ontario to South Portland, Maine where it would be shipped by tanker
to the Gulf of Mexico.
The pipeline would pass next to Sebago Lake, the drinking water supply for more than 15% of Maine people,
and could endanger Casco Bay and our fishing and lobster industries.
